Cutting Capacity
Cutting capacity is the most important factor, as it determines the maximum thickness of the material a machine can cut. This is usually specified in two ways: clean cut, which is the maximum thickness for a smooth, high-quality cut, and severance cut, which is the absolute maximum thickness it can get through, albeit with a rougher edge. A higher amperage rating directly translates to greater cutting capacity, allowing you to work with thicker materials.
Pilot Arc vs. High-Frequency Start
Pilot arc technology is a must-have for those cutting on painted, rusty, or expanded metal surfaces. Unlike traditional drag-start cutters, a pilot arc creates a non-contact arc that can start a cut without touching the workpiece. This not only makes the process easier but also extends the life of your consumables. High-frequency starts are similar but can cause interference with sensitive electronics, so pilot arc is often preferred for general-purpose use. You can read more about it here: The Wikipedia guide on plasma cutting.
Duty Cycle
The duty cycle tells you how long a plasma cutter can run at a specific amperage before it needs to cool down. A 60% duty cycle at 50 amps means the machine can cut for 6 minutes out of every 10-minute period. A higher duty cycle is crucial for professionals and those with large projects, as it allows for longer, continuous cutting sessions without interruptions. For light use, a lower duty cycle may suffice.
Portability and Voltage
Consider the machine’s size and weight, especially if you plan to move it between different locations. Many modern plasma cutters are compact and lightweight. Additionally, look for a dual-voltage machine (110V/220V). This feature provides great flexibility, allowing you to use it in a standard home garage with a 110V outlet or in a workshop with a dedicated 220V circuit for maximum power and performance.
Consumables and Torch Design
The torch and its consumables (electrodes, tips, swirl rings) are critical for a quality cut. A well-designed torch provides a comfortable grip and precise control. Check for the availability and cost of consumables; a machine that uses widely available parts can save you money and hassle in the long run. Different torches, like the PT31 or IPT40, are designed for specific tasks and can affect cutting performance.

How to Use Best Arc Plasma Cutter
Using a plasma cutter is a straightforward process, but a few key steps will help you achieve clean, precise results.
- Setup and Prep: First, connect your machine to a power source and an air compressor. Ensure the air pressure is set to the manufacturer’s recommended PSI. Secure your workpiece with a clamp or vice and ensure the ground clamp is attached to a clean, bare metal surface on the workpiece.
- Core Usage & Best Practices: For pilot arc models, hold the torch tip a small distance (about 1/8 inch) above the metal. Pull the trigger and let the pilot arc ignite. Once it does, slowly and steadily move the torch along your cutting line. For drag-start models, simply drag the tip along the surface as you cut. Maintain a consistent travel speed for the cleanest possible cut.
- Optimization & Safety: Adjust the amperage to match the thickness of your material. A higher amperage is needed for thicker metals. Always use proper ventilation and wear all necessary safety gear. Ensure your consumables are in good condition; a worn tip can lead to a messy, uneven cut.
- Troubleshooting: If your cut is not clean, check your air pressure and amperage settings. If the arc sputters or is difficult to start, your consumables may be worn and need to be replaced. Refer to the machine’s manual for specific error codes and troubleshooting guides.
Frequently Asked Questions
What is the difference between a plasma cutter and a torch?
A plasma cutter uses a high-speed jet of ionized gas to cut metal, which results in a faster, cleaner, and more precise cut with less heat-affected zone. An oxy-acetylene torch uses a chemical reaction of oxygen and fuel gas to heat and melt the metal, often leaving a wider, rougher cut and more slag. A best arc plasma cutter is a great choice.
Can a plasma cutter cut through painted or rusty metal?
Yes, a plasma cutter with a pilot arc function is specifically designed to cut through painted, rusty, and coated metals. The non-contact pilot arc can bridge the gap and initiate the cut without needing a clean surface, making it highly effective and versatile for a variety of tasks.
What kind of air compressor do I need for a plasma cutter?
Most plasma cutters require a compressed air supply. The size of the compressor you need depends on the cutter’s CFM (Cubic Feet per Minute) requirement. A standard 50A plasma cutter usually needs an air compressor with a minimum of 4-6 CFM at 60-70 PSI. Always check the manufacturer’s specifications for the best results.
How long do plasma cutter consumables last?
The lifespan of consumables depends on several factors, including cutting amperage, air pressure, and the type of material being cut. Using a pilot arc can extend their life, as it reduces direct contact with the workpiece. On average, a set of consumables can last anywhere from a few hours to several weeks of intermittent use.
Can a plasma cutter cut aluminum?
Yes, plasma cutters are excellent for cutting aluminum. Since aluminum is a highly conductive metal, it is a great material to work with using a plasma cutter.
